Output 1c84766371051647503f5f39c3b22df0de13c902b4c879b7b1e1593f321c0ebc:0

value
3145040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676855913c6acd85e0f202def4ec072de99b0d02 OP_EQUAL
address
3B7nWaBRzYvDjU5d1pyD84guLXXs66oKYP
transaction
1c84766371051647503f5f39c3b22df0de13c902b4c879b7b1e1593f321c0ebc
confirmations
363097
spent
true